2
Riverside.fm logo

Riverside.fm

Record podcasts and videos remotely

Freemium4.2/5(1,661)

Key features

  • Local recording up to 4K video and 48kHz uncompressed audio
  • Text-based video editor with transcript-driven editing
  • AI noise removal and audio enhancement

Pros

  • Local recording ensures studio quality regardless of internet connection
  • Text-based editing makes video editing accessible to non-editors

Cons

  • Free plan limited to 2 hours of multi-track recording with watermark
  • Webinar features require the $79/mo plan which is a steep jump from Pro

Spreaker logo

Spreaker

Create, distribute, and monetize podcasts

Freemium4.0/5(103)

Key features

  • Unlimited episode uploads on all plans
  • Auto-distribution to Spotify, Apple Podcasts, iHeartRadio
  • Built-in ad monetization and Supporters Club

Pros

  • Free plan includes unlimited episodes and distribution
  • Built-in monetization from day one

Cons

  • Free plan limited to one podcast and 6-month stats
  • Advanced features like collaboration locked to higher tiers

Acast logo

Acast

Podcast hosting and monetization

Freemium3.9/5(7)

Key features

  • Podcast hosting
  • Dynamic ads
  • Distribution

Pros

  • Offers an all-in-one platform for managing, publishing, distributing, and monetizing podcasts.
  • Provides advanced monetization options including premium ads, sponsorships, and listener subscriptions (via Supercast), with transparent revenue tracking.

Cons

  • The 'Starter' free plan is limited to 1 show and 5 episodes, with unlimited episodes only available if the show is in Acast's advertising marketplace.
  • Advanced features like team management, prioritized support, and a publishing API are only available on the highest-tier 'Ace' plan.

Podcast Hosting for Freelancers: what to know

Freelancers (project-based independent workers — designers, developers, writers, consultants, marketers) have software needs centered on client capture + delivery + getting paid.

The dominant freelance management platforms: Bonsai, HoneyBook, Dubsado, 17hats, FreshBooks (with proposal + invoicing), Hectic, AND.CO. These bundle proposal/contract/invoice/payment in one workflow.

Above that: time tracking if billing hourly (Toggl, Harvest, Timely), portfolio + presence (own site or Behance/Dribbble for designers), and finding work (Upwork, Fiverr, Toptal, Contra, niche communities like Polywork).

The financial reality most freelancers underrate: rate-setting matters more than tool choice. Freelancers undercharge by 30-50% on average; rate calculators (Bonsai Rate Calculator, freelancehourlyrate.com) plus competitive research win more than any single piece of tech.

Challenges Freelancers face

  • Underpricing rates is the #1 mistake; competitive research is rarely done
  • Scope creep on fixed-fee projects eats margin
  • Cash flow timing — net 30 payment from clients vs immediate expenses
  • Tax: 1099 income + estimated quarterly payments + state nexus
  • Pipeline visibility — feast or famine cycle without active marketing
